Integrated Fridge Freezers

Invisibly concealed behind subdued fascias, fridge freezers that are integrated serve as a subdued part of your dream kitchen. But don't let them fool you - they're packed with cavernous storage and advanced technology such as wine racks, four adjustable door shelves, and twin vegetable and fruit bins.

They may also be equipped with Hettich or Ingol hinges, ensuring long-lasting performance.

Size

Integrated fridge-freezers are designed to be inserted directly into your cabinetry. They're usually smaller than freestanding models. If you want a sleek appliance that blends into counters and cabinets They can be a great option. They're also a great option for those who don't have the space in your home for a separate freezer.

However, there are some things to consider when deciding on an integrated fridge freezer. One of the main reasons they are more expensive is the fact that they are built-in models. This is due to the additional costs of buying and installing a fridge cabinet, kitchen cabinet doors, and a bridging cabinet to make the refrigerator integrated.

Another aspect to be aware of is that fridge freezers integrated can be difficult to service. It is necessary to remove the refrigerator from its housing cabinet and rehang the doors to the kitchen cabinet. This can take several months or even weeks. It's therefore important to hire a reliable kitchen fitting service that will take the time to do the job right.

When you're considering the purchase of a new fridge freezer with integrated features, it's important to carefully measure the space before purchasing it. Be sure to leave some space on either side of the appliance for you to to open the doors. Also, you should examine the hinges on the doors of the refrigerator. A lot of cheap models have inferior hinges that aren't made to handle the weight of a refrigerator and can break after a couple of months.

Integrated fridge-freezers are available in different width sizes that will help you to maximize the storage space. The depth of the fridge can also affect your kitchen cabinets. If you're planning to put tall cabinets above your refrigerator, you may require the appliance made to a custom length to ensure it will fit. Check that the ventilation of the fridge has been cut correctly. If not, you could have issues later.

Style

It is important to take into consideration various factors prior to making a decision. The integrated fridge freezer is often preferred over freestanding models because they offer a sleek and seamless look to your kitchen. They're designed to blend into cabinetry rather than standing out and dominating the room.

They typically sit flush with the surrounding counters and cabinets with their doors being inset so that they don't stand out. They are usually panel-ready for a more streamlined finish to your kitchen. Many come with stainless steel fronts to give an elegant and contemporary appearance.

Despite their appearance, they don't sacrifice storage space as the freezer section can still be very Large Fridge Freezers Uk and is typically located at the bottom of the appliance to give ample space for frozen food items. There is also a range of widths available. The majority of brands offer between 20-24 inches of width that are larger than freestanding freezers.

Due to their design and the fact that they are integrated into your kitchen you will probably find integrated fridges to be more expensive than fridge freezers that are freestanding. This is mainly because the cost of a fridge's housing cabinet as well as the kitchen cabinets that make the surround will push up the overall price.

They can be more difficult to move when you plan to move home which can be a challenge for some people. It is necessary to disassemble the entire unit from its cabinetry. It's not as simple as unplugging and removing the appliance as you would with a freestanding model.

The integrated fridges freezers are also more difficult to repair since they are a part of your kitchen. In the event of an issue, you'll require a fridge freezer uk sale technician to take apart and replace any damaged parts. This is expensive and definitely more expensive than purchasing an entirely new fridge freezer as replacement.

A high-efficiency integrated fridge freezer can cut down on your household expenses. It will also help save energy by reducing the time it runs and will be more environmentally friendly because it uses less power. Make sure you buy a model with an A or B energy rating to make a real difference.

In contrast to freestanding fridge freezers with a separate housing integrated models come with doors built into the cabinetry. This lets the fridge blend seamlessly into the kitchen and create an elegant, uniform look. Certain models come with sliding doors that allow you to open the fridge without opening the cabinet door. Others are panel-ready, meaning that they can be overlaid with a cabinet door to disguise the fridge behind cabinets in your kitchen.

The drawbacks of integrated fridge freezers are that they tend to be more expensive than other alternatives. This is partly because they're made in smaller quantities and tend to be more of a premium market however, it's also due to the additional costs that come in the installation process. Additional hinges and panels, as well as the extra costs of making your furniture fit around the fridge are all aspects.

Some integrated fridge freezers require more maintenance, and others need to be defrosted frequently to remove the accumulation of ice. Certain models have been designed to minimise the requirement for this, such as Beko's range of fridge freezers that are integrated with frost-free technology, which reduces defrosting and helps reduce maintenance.

The capacity of a fridge/freezer integrated is a different aspect to consider. The more litres, the more food you can store. Look for models that have at least 150 litres of storage in the fridge, and up to 350 litres in the freezer. You can pick from a variety of storage options, including drawers and flexible shelving that offer plenty of space for fresh produce, or bottle racks to hold larger milk bottles. There are fridge freezers with integrated refrigerators with 50/50 splits that can be used to store frozen and chilled food items.

Stores

The main benefit of integrated fridge freezers is that they take up less space than freestanding models, which helps you make the most of your kitchen. They can also be positioned flush with counters and cabinets and create a seamless look. This style does mean that they have less storage space than their freestanding counterparts.

They also cost more to purchase and operate than freestanding refrigerator freezers that meet similar specifications. This is due to many factors that include their high cost of development and manufacturing, the fact they are considered a luxury item as well as the additional cost of installation and customization.

Additionally, integrated fridge freezers can be more difficult to access than their freestanding counterparts, which can create problems when you need them serviced. This is especially the case if you choose a cheap fridge freezer integrated fridge freezer that has hinges that are poorly constructed, and can break easily over time.

The size of your family and storage needs will determine the most efficient integrated fridge freezer. Think about how much you'd like to store in your refrigerator, and whether you'll be storing large platters or frozen food items. The majority of fridge freezers with integrated refrigerators will have capacities between 150 and 350 litres which can store up to 19 shopping bags.

The best integrated refrigerator freezers have features that will keep your food healthy and fresh. Some models will come with airflow technology, which distributes cool air evenly over the shelves, while others will come with antibacterial linings to eliminate odours. Certain models have a quick freeze feature that decreases the temperature of your freezer quickly which allows you to store fresh food items without them freezing solid.

For those who like to keep their fish, meat and dairy at a specific temperature, consider integrating fridge freezers with a BioFresh compartment. These compartments are maintained at a low humidity, which will keep your fish, meat, and dairy fresher for longer than a typical fridge freezer. Fruits and vegetables remain crisper for longer in the HydroSafe compartment which is kept at a high humidity.
